Quick dinner: Veggie rolls

On a day when we had the basic vegetables- potato, carrot and capsicum and were out of options and patience to make dinner, we decided to try making rolls. Chapathis are anyway prepared for dinner everyday. So it was just a matter of fixing something for the filling.

Method:

Dice the carrots and potatoes into cubes and pressure cook them until they are just about done and not very soft. Chop the capsicum well. Heat oil in a pan. Throw in some mustard and jeera. Wait until you hear the chata-pata sound. Add a bunch of chopped methi leaves if available. Add the capsicum to this and fry well. Once it is fried, add in the cooked vegetables. Season with salt and coarsely ground pepper-jeera.
